技术领域technical field
本实用新型属于塑料注塑技术领域,具体涉及一种热固性模具直浇口自动切断装置。The utility model belongs to the technical field of plastic injection molding, in particular to an automatic cutting device for a sprue of a thermosetting mold.
背景技术Background technique
当今世界,塑料材料及其制品的应用已涉及到各行各业、方方面面、以至每一个家庭,越来越多的企业人士参与到塑料制品的生产与销售中来。In today's world, the application of plastic materials and their products has involved all walks of life, all aspects, and even every family. More and more business people are involved in the production and sales of plastic products.
目前在热固注塑行业中,通常情况下要分离直浇口的产品与料把,只能通过后工程治具等进行浇道剪切。这种情况下,会降低生产效率,也会增加人工成本。因此需要提供一种在不增加人工成本情况下,可以自动剪切浇口装置。At present, in the thermosetting injection molding industry, it is usually necessary to separate the product and the material of the sprue, and the runner can only be sheared by the post-engineering fixture. In this case, the production efficiency will be reduced, and the labor cost will also be increased. Therefore, it is necessary to provide a gate device that can automatically cut the gate without increasing the labor cost.
实用新型内容Utility model content
为了解决上述技术问题,本实用新型提出一种可在生产过程中自动切断直浇口的装置,该装置通过注塑机推杆向前推动模具推板B和推板底板B,切刀跟随模具推板B向前移动切直浇口,实现浇口切断,顶出料把,取出制品。In order to solve the above technical problems, the utility model proposes a device that can automatically cut off the sprue in the production process. The plate B moves forward to cut the gate straight, realizes the gate cut off, ejects the discharge handle, and takes out the product.
本实用新型采用如下技术方案:The utility model adopts the following technical solutions:
一种热固性模具直浇口自动切断装置,所述装置包括推板底板B、模具推板B、推板底板A、模具推板A、切刀、注塑机推杆、直浇口、复位杆A、动模板、模具动模底板、复位杆B,所述复位杆A与模具推板A相连,所述模具推板A与动模板相连,所述模具推板A上装配有顶出杆,所述推板底板A与模具推板A相连,所述模具推板B上装配有复位杆B、切刀,所述切刀贯穿推板底板A与模具推板A直至直浇口,所述推板底板B与模具推板B相连,所述推板底板B与模具动模底板相连,所述注塑机推杆穿过模具动模底板顶至推板底板B。A thermosetting mold sprue automatic cutting device, the device comprises a push plate bottom plate B, a mold push plate B, a push plate bottom plate A, a mold push plate A, a cutter, an injection molding machine push rod, a sprue, and a reset rod A , a moving template, a mold moving mold base plate, a reset rod B, the reset rod A is connected with the mold push plate A, the mold push plate A is connected with the moving template, and the mold push plate A is equipped with an ejector rod, so The bottom plate A of the push plate is connected with the mold push plate A, and the mold push plate B is equipped with a reset rod B and a cutter, and the cutter runs through the push plate bottom plate A and the mold push plate A until the gate, and the The plate bottom B is connected with the mold push plate B, the push plate bottom B is connected with the mold movable mold bottom plate, and the injection molding machine push rod passes through the mold movable mold bottom plate and is pushed to the push plate bottom plate B.
进一步地,所述切刀的顶端与产品分型面调整到同一平面。Further, the top end of the cutter and the product parting surface are adjusted to the same plane.
进一步地,所述直浇口的厚度值为推板底板A和模具推板B之间的距离。Further, the thickness value of the sprue is the distance between the bottom plate A of the push plate and the push plate B of the mold.
本实用新型的优点与效果为:The advantages and effects of the utility model are:
本实用新型装置通过缩小推板间的距离,来实现切刀自动切断浇口。本装置需在模具开模前,先将直浇口自动切断,然后再开模将料把顶出,取出产品。结构简单,方便实用。本实用新型装置优化工作流程,降低人工成本,提高工作效率。The device of the utility model realizes the automatic cutting of the gate by the cutter by reducing the distance between the push plates. This device needs to automatically cut off the sprue before the mold is opened, and then open the mold to eject the material and take out the product. Simple structure, convenient and practical. The device of the utility model optimizes the work flow, reduces the labor cost and improves the work efficiency.

一种直浇口自动切断装置包括:模具推板A 4、模具推板B 2、推板底板A 3、推板底板B 1、切刀5、复位杆A 8、复位杆B 11、模具动模底板10、动模板9。A sprue automatic cutting device includes: mold push plate A 4, mold
所述复位杆A 8安装于模具推板A4对角部,所述模具推板A4与动模板9相连,图中模具推板A 4与动模板9之间是推板移动空间,所述模具推板A4上装配有顶出杆,所述推板底板A3装配于模具推板A4下方,所述模具推板B2上装配有复位杆B11、切刀5,所述切刀5贯穿推板底板A3与模具推板A4直至直浇口7,复位杆B11安装在模具推板A2上并贯穿推板底板A3和模具推板A4,上部与动模板留有活动空间所述切刀5的顶端与产品分型面调整到同一平面。所述直浇口7的厚度值为推板底板A3和模具推板B2之间的距离。所述推板底板B1安装于模具推板B2下部,所述推板底板B1下方装配模具动模底板10,所述注塑机推杆6穿过模具动模底板10推动推板底板B1。The reset rod A8 is installed on the diagonal part of the mold push plate A4, and the mold push plate A4 is connected with the
实施例1Example 1
先将模具推板A 4和复位杆A 8安装在动模板9上,再将顶出杆安装在模具推板A 4上。然后安装推板底板A 3和模具推板B 2,拧紧推板底板A 3上的螺钉,将推板底板A 3和模具推板A 4固定在一起。在模具推板B 2上安装复位杆B 11、切刀5,切刀5的顶端与产品分型面调整到同一平面。再安装推板底板B1。最后安装动模底板10。将模具推板B 2和推板底板B1固定在动模底板10上。把直浇口7的厚度值设定为推板底板A 3和模具推板B 2之间的距离。目的是为了在模具开模前,注塑机推杆6向前推动模具推板B 2和推板底板B 1,切刀5跟随模具推板B 2向前移动开始切直浇口7。当模具推板B 2与推板底板A 3直接触碰时,直浇口7完全切断。浇口切断后,模具开模,同时推板与顶出杆继续向前移动,顶出料把,取出制品。Install the mold push plate A 4 and the
